Evans Ochieng is my name. I'm a married man, a father of two children. My home county is Siaya, where I was born in the year 1994. I started schooling at Sega Primary School, from where I graduated in 2007. I then joined Sifuyo Secondary School from 2008 to 2011. I then joined Mawego National Polytechnic from 2015 to 2018. I graduated with Diploma in Food and Beverage Management.
I got employed as the Kitchen Manager at Homabay Hotel from 2020, where I worked until 2024, before I lost my job. Refusing to bow to the situation, I came up with a group of flying chefs, when I moved to Nairobi.
Since then, I have employed 7 young people who work under my initiative as flying chefs, who are hired during events to handle culinary matters. I also have a small hotel where we make various foods for sale, especially the fast moving street food loved by city dwellers.
